Handwritten codicils to wills are accepted and considered legal in Alberta if properly executed. The same as another codicils, handwritten codicils must be formally and clearly dated and signed to be legally binding.
In short, no a Codicil to a Will does not have to be docHubd. However, laws and requirements vary from Province to Province. A Codicil does have to be signed in front of at least two witnesses who are not listed as beneficiaries, guardians, or executors in your Will.
Sign and date the codicil or new will in the presence of at least two adult witnesses who are not beneficiaries of the will. Witnesses must also sign and date the document to confirm its authenticity. Once you complete this step, your codicil or new will is legally binding.
I hereby amend my will as follows: It sets out the change(s) that the testator is making to their will using the Codicil. For example, it could set out the testators wish to appoint a certain person as a new executor, to remove somebody as a guardian, or to increase the amount of money left to somebody.
Write the opening paragraph. Include the date of your original will in your codicil. Including this date will show that you are aware of the original document and help prevent those who interpret your will from thinking that you may have created this document without knowledge of the original will.
